解决git克隆/上传速度过慢

注: 使用本文的前提是已经购买了梯子,并且使用相关的软件进行代理之后的操作。

问题原因:从github上clone或者download一个项目很慢。

1. 设置代理

你需要知道你本地的socks5代理ip地址和端口。

如果socks5(SSR)

例如。127.0.0.1端口1080
然后使用此命令设置代理

git config --global http.https://github.com.proxy socks5://127.0.0.1:1080
git config --global https.https://github.com.proxy socks5://127.0.0.1:1080

如果http / https

使用此命令:

git config --global https.proxy http://127.0.0.1:1080
git config --global https.proxy https://127.0.0.1:1080

2. 取消代理

git config --global --unset http.proxy
git config --global --unset https.proxy

常用的github镜像代理

  • 官网镜像(可以用来clone push等,但是不能登录)
https://github.com.cnpmjs.org/
https://git.sdut.me/
https://hub.fastgit.org/

【github】解决git克隆/上传速度过慢相关推荐

  1. 超详细简单解决git的上传和下载

    Git 背景 Git的作用 下载git教程 安装注意事项 创建github账号及创建仓库和上传项目 下载项目到本地 背景 GIT,全称是分布式版本控制系统,git通常在编程中会用到,并且git支持分布 ...

  2. 登入Github、Git本地上传及Visual Studio Code上传教程

    GitHub 一.显示图片问题 1.1 连接失败 1.2 github图片不正常显示 二.GitHub本地上传 2.1 直接使用git命令 2.2 VS Code上传 一.显示图片问题 1.1 连接失 ...

  3. 【github】Git LFS上传大文件到github

    GitHub Desktop 包含用于管理大文件的 Git Large File Storage,即GLT FS.Git LFS 可让您将文件推送到超出 100 MB 正常限制的 GitHub. 所以 ...

  4. “Hello,Github!——如何配置并上传一个已有项目到Git上

    "Hello,Github!"--如何配置并上传一个已有项目到Git上           注意!前言十分简短!      如今,Github已经成为了管理软件开发以及发现别人优秀 ...

  5. 将本地项目上传到Github的两种方式 1.在线上传 2.使用Git客户端上传

    文章目录 注册GitHub账号并创建仓库 上传本地项目到Github的方式一:在线上传 上传本地项目到Github的方式二:使用Git客户端上传 Windows下安装Git客户端 Git配置本地用户名 ...

  6. eclipse下使用git插件上传代码至github

    eclipse下使用git插件上传代码至github 1.eclipse下安装git 正常情况下,eclipse 是自带 git 插件的,那么即可跳至步骤1的最后一小步,配置 git . 如果十分悲剧 ...

  7. 如何将本地文件利用git工具上传到github仓库中(超详细+最新版)

    https://blog.csdn.net/hanhanwanghaha宝藏女孩 欢迎您的关注! 欢迎关注微信公众号:宝藏女孩的成长日记 如有转载,请注明出处(如不注明,盗者必究) 如何将本地文件利用 ...

  8. 手把手教你上手Git并上传项目到GitHub官网

    手把手教你上手Git并上传项目到GitHub官网 Learning Git Branch: 学习 Git 最好的游戏及教程 https://learngitbranching.js.org 这个就是那 ...

  9. git学习——上传项目代码到github

     1.注册账户以及创建仓库      要想使用github第一步当然是注册github账号了.之后就可以创建仓库了(免费用户只能建公共仓库),Create a New Repository,填好名称后 ...

最新文章

  1. 请还互联网产业一个朗朗乾坤
  2. php传值到模板,laravel 实现向公共模板中传值 (view composer)
  3. 【深度学习】利用神网框架分割病理切片中的癌组织(胃)
  4. 测量分类准确率的过程算坍缩吗?
  5. VTK:Rendering之Cone4
  6. 怎样通过DOS来提取一个文件夹下所有文件的名字
  7. oracle 拷贝文件到asm,Oracle 从ASM复制文件到文件系统
  8. 74HC595芯片使用说明
  9. matlab int 积不出,matlab – 点积:*命令与循环给出不同的结果
  10. 分类信息网站源码_分类信息网站如何增加搜索引收录
  11. 2018 CCPC 桂林站小结
  12. Android学习笔记17:单项选择RadioButton和多项选择CheckBox的使用
  13. 实战 Kaggle 比赛:狗的品种识别(ImageNet Dogs) 动手学深度学习v2 pytorch
  14. Unity3D 虚拟现实开发(一)
  15. @submit.native.prevent的作用?
  16. 物理学经济学java周易_八竿子打不着?——物理学和经济学的相似相通之处
  17. Java面试题及答案,javaSE阶段
  18. 公司25k招了一个测试员不会自动化,试用期没过就赶走了...
  19. 『方案』《女友十年精华》 ORC 图片 文字识别 详解
  20. mysqlbug日记

热门文章

  1. withRouter() 在非路由组件中使用路由库的api
  2. 在出售或赠送MacBook之前如何将其恢复出厂设置
  3. 关于微信端领取到卡包,由于异步执行操作,导致领取到卡包的时候数据异常
  4. 关闭了朋友圈之后……
  5. 判断链表是否有环(Java)
  6. AndroidAuto连接流程及代码实现
  7. 贪吃蛇java代码_java实现贪吃蛇的代码实例
  8. 2006年大学生就业“力”调查:你值多少钱
  9. 搭建服务器部署聊天机器人记录
  10. NLP文本分类入门学习及TextCnn实践笔记——模型训练(三)